2024 has already seen significant developments in employment and immigration law. The new tax year brought legislative changes to flexible working, redundancy protection and sexual harassment. We are also seeing an increase in cases on neurodiversity, menopause and conflicting beliefs in the workplace. If the general election delivers a Labour government as many predict, there is likely to be further major changes to the employment law landscape including the possible removal of the two year service requirement for unfair dismissal claims.
